A fun writing exercise (started when I should’ve been working on my Edinburgh Fringe show) that somehow turned into a proper thing. I began jotting down names, staring out of the window, and listing all the stuff that gets on my nerves (cooking, cars, jogging). And now, here we are: a lovely—if I may say so myself—collection of short stories about normal people struggling with really basic things.

Perfect toilet reading, perhaps, given how short they are. Or something to dip in and out of while you're parked up in Waitrose car park waiting for your mum to do her shopping.

Features three swear words and possibly a couple of typos.

About the author

Paul S. Richards is a writer based in Cambridge, England. He’s 44 and often talks about himself in the third person. Over the past 20 years, he’s taken more than thirty plays to the Edinburgh Fringe, earning a fair bit of acclaim along the way—most notably for Harvey Greenfield is Running Late, which was later developed into a feature film.

He drinks too much coffee and is determined to grow a beard one day.
